What Chicago's Environment Does to Water Heaters

The lake moderates summer heat a little bit, yet it likewise pulls moisture right into fall and springtime. Winters are cool and prolonged, and the chilly water entering your heater can run 35 to 45 levels Fahrenheit. That broad delta from inlet to setpoint temperature level suggests your heater functions harder for even more months of the year. Gas models cycle regularly. Electric aspects run much longer sessions. Tankless devices are pressed to the top edge of their circulation rankings when two components open at once.

Hard water compounds the stress and anxiety. Numerous Chicago communities test at moderate to high firmness, which accelerates range build-up on electric aspects and gas-fired warm transfer surface areas. I have actually drained containers where the bottom 6 inches were clogged with crispy mineral debris, reducing reliable ability and covering up thermostat issues. Cold air seepage is one more offender, particularly in basements with older single-pane home windows or drafty bulkhead doors. Combustion devices require air, but too much unrestrained air cools the tank and flue, raises condensation, and causes intermittent flame-sensing faults.

If your hot water heater is near an exterior wall or in a garage, the results turn up quicker. Burners corrosion. Air vent connectors drip. Condensate pools where it should not. Plan for inspection and solution cadence that values these facts. A heating unit that would run 8 to ten years in a light climate could require interest by year six here.

How to Place Trouble Before It Spikes

Most failures offer warnings. You simply need to acknowledge them and act. A few field notes:

A warm water supply that turns from warm to scalding and back suggests a failing thermostat or clogged mixing shutoff. On gas units, irregular temperature level often begins after sediment has buried the bottom, creating hot spots that confuse the control.

Popping, rumbling, or a gravelly noise during heater cycles usually indicates scale and debris. The noise is steam popping underneath layers of mineral buildup, which likewise steals efficiency. In worst cases the roaring drinks apart dip tubes and anode rods.

Rust-tinted hot water that clears after a couple of minutes generally implies an anode pole has actually been eaten and the container is beginning to corrode. If the discoloration appears on both hot and cold, look upstream at the building's piping, yet don't dismiss the heating unit without drawing the anode for inspection.

Drips near the temperature level and stress safety valve can be deceptive. If the shutoff weeps just throughout a heating cycle after that stops, thermal growth may be driving pressure beyond the valve's limit. Chicago homes with shut systems or check shutoffs on the water meter usually require an appropriately sized growth container. If the shutoff cries regularly, replace it and test system pressure.

Intermittent warm water on a tankless system when you open up a solitary low-flow faucet can indicate the minimum flow sensor isn't being triggered. Mineral range in the heat exchanger is an usual cause. Don't keep raising the temperature level to make up, you'll create a scald danger and still obtain warm water.

Gas smell, scorch marks, or residue around the burner compartment suggests shut it down and call an expert. In older cellars with dust and family pet hair, I usually locate fire rollout evidence from clogged up combustion air intakes.

Repair or Change: The Genuine Equation

I don't utilize a rigorous age cutoff, but age matters. A lot of standard glass-lined tanks last 8 to 12 years when fairly kept. In devices with overlooked anodes or serious water problems, 6 to 8 years prevails. At the 10-year mark, despite a tidy heater and sound controls, inside container wear comes to be the coin toss you will not such as. If the tank itself leakages, replacement is non-negotiable. No sealer or epoxy is greater than a momentary bandage.

For repair service candidates, I check out element expenses, accessibility, and expected perspective. Changing gas control valves, thermocouples, igniters, or thermostats often makes sense for younger systems. So does exchanging a fallen short burner on an electric model. Anode poles are cheap insurance policy, and I have replaced them on containers as old as year nine when the inside still looked good. But if the burner setting up is worn away, the flue baffle is distorted, or you can not isolate the leak without pressurizing, I push property owners towards replacement.

Efficiency gains often tip the equilibrium. More recent gas or crossbreed electrical versions utilize much less power per gallon supplied, and tankless devices have improved modulating controls that react much better to Chicago's cool inlet water. If your existing heating unit is undersized, replacing with the appropriate capability or a tankless system solves both dependability and comfort.

Sizing for Real-life Chicago Use

A well-sized system does not chase peak draw, it meets it without losing gas the other 23 hours. Sizing obtains harder when a home has an older whirlpool bathtub, a multi-head shower, or a basement apartment with an extra bath.

For containers, overall restroom count, occupancy, and component habits drive the option. A home of four with two full baths and normal early morning overlap hardly ever regrets a 50-gallon gas container if the recuperation rate is strong. A 40-gallon version can benefit regimented routines, but if both showers run and washing starts, it will certainly falter. Electric storage tanks need bigger abilities to match the recuperation of gas. I usually spec 65 to 80 gallons for all-electric homes with 2 or more baths.

For tankless, match the unit to the chilliest expected incoming temperature level and synchronised circulation. In Chicago winter seasons, prepare for a temperature level increase of 70 to 85 levels. 2 showers plus a sink might need 6 to 8 gallons per min at that rise. Makers list circulation capability at particular delta-T values. Review those tables, not simply the headline GPM. If area enables, some two-flats gain from 2 smaller sized tankless units in parallel as opposed to one oversized device, which enhances redundancy and modulates much more effectively on reduced draws.

Gas, Electric, Hybrid, or Tankless: Making a Resilient Choice

There is no widely ideal choice. Your gas line size, venting course, electrical capability, and area layout determine what's functional. After that the math of power prices and your use patterns finish the picture.

Traditional gas storage tank hot water heater being in the wonderful place of price, simple installment, and dependable recovery. They're familiar to examiners and service technologies. If you have a respectable smokeshaft or a direct-vent path, they function well in most Chicago basements. They are delicate to cosmetics air and venting problem, which is why you ought to check the flue regularly for rust or ice dams near the cap.

High-efficiency gas with power vent or condensing layouts utilizes PVC venting and can be extra efficient, specifically when you can't rely upon a masonry chimney. They need a correct condensate drainpipe line that won't freeze. The air vent runs have to be pitched to drain, and the discontinuation should be sited to prevent snow drift zones.

Electric storage tanks are less complex mechanically, without any combustion or airing vent to stress over. They can be outstanding in condominiums or buildings without gas. The trade-off is healing rate and electrical lots. If your panel is maxed out currently, including a large electric heating system might water heater maintenance compel a solution upgrade.

Hybrid heat pump hot water heater radiate in removed homes with adequate space and light ambient temperatures. They draw warmth from the surrounding air and are very effective. In Chicago cellars, they still function, but they cool down and evaporate the room. That can be an advantage in summer, a downside in wintertime. Clearances, condensate handling, and noise issue, specifically if the device is near a living location. I've set up hybrids in laundry rooms where the clothes dryer's waste warmth aids, however in small mechanical storage rooms they can struggle.

Tankless gas units maximize floor area and provide unlimited hot water within their circulation restrictions. They are sensitive to water high quality and call for routine descaling. Airing vent is normally secured and sidewall-terminated, which commonly simplifies flue problems. They do require adequate gas supply, occasionally upsizing the line to 3/4 inch or larger. Properly mounted and preserved, they last a long time and keep expenses predictable.

Chicago Building Realities: Airing Vent, Permits, and Access

Venting is where many DIY attempts go sideways. Older two-flats and bungalows frequently share a chimney flue between the water heater and a climatic furnace. If the heater obtains replaced with a high-efficiency model that vents with PVC, the water heater ends up alone in a too-large chimney. That alters draft characteristics and threats condensation inside the masonry. I have measured flue gas temperature levels that drop also rapidly, merging acidic condensate in linings. If you go this path, think about an appropriately sized metal liner or switch the heating unit to a power-vent or direct-vent model.

Chicago's permitting procedure for water heater installation is uncomplicated when you adhere to code and offer standard paperwork. Anticipate gas pressure examinations for new or revised lines, combustion air computations if you are sticking with atmospheric home appliances, and evaluation of TPR discharge piping. In older structures, inspectors likewise consider bonding and grounding of steel water lines. Organizing is much easier midweek and outside vacation weeks. If your building is a condo, consider board authorizations and lift reservations for relocating tanks.

Access shapes labor time. Garden units with slim gangways and low stairwell turns limit container size merely since you can't physically maneuver a larger cylinder. I have actually had work where a 50-gallon storage tank needed to be disassembled to eliminate, after that we shifted to a tankless to stay clear of future access migraines. Procedure doorways, turns, and ceiling elevations before you decide on a model.

Maintenance That Really Extends Life

Yearly service defeats surprise failings. In our environment, the complying with tempo works. Drain a couple of gallons from the container every 6 months to flush sediment. Complete flushes are suitable if the valve is durable, but I have actually seen old plastic drainpipe shutoffs snap. If the shutoff feels lightweight, a partial drain and refill is safer. On electric storage tanks, eliminate power initially and examine element resistance with a multimeter while you're there.

Inspect and change the anode rod every 2 to 3 years. In high-hardness locations, magnesium anodes dissolve swiftly. An aluminum-zinc anode can reduce smell concerns from sulfur germs and lasts a bit longer. If you don't have above clearance, utilize a fractional anode. When anodes are disregarded, the container comes to be the sacrificial metal, and failure accelerates.

For gas versions, vacuum cleaner dust and lint from the burner location. Clean flame-sensing poles delicately with a great AO Smith water heater rough pad. Examine that the fire is secure and mostly blue with well-defined cones. Lazy yellow flames show bad combustion or obstructed air. Verify that the draft hood is drawing by holding a smoke resource near it while the burner runs. If smoke spills out, stop and deal with venting.

Tankless devices need yearly descaling in many Chicago areas. Make use of a pump, pipes, and a descaling service to distribute with the warmth exchanger. Clean inlet filters. Validate the condensate neutralizer media is still reliable on condensing models. I have seen disregarded tankless systems keep up half the expected circulation because the exchanger was lined with mineral crust.

Expansion storage tanks are worthy of a pressure check too. With the system cold and pressure happy, the expansion storage tank's air side should match your home's water heater permits Chicago static water pressure, generally 50 to 60 psi. A water logged growth storage tank creates annoyance TPR discharges and shortens the life of valves and gaskets downstream.

When To Call for Professional Water Heater Solution in Chicago

Some issues are secure to investigate on your own, like inspecting the breaker, relighting a pilot per the guidebook, or flushing debris. Others warrant a pro. Gas leakages, flue backdrafting, scorch marks, and recurring TPR discharges drop in that category. So do new electric runs for crossbreed or huge electric containers and any kind of modification to gas lines.

A good service visit isn't simply a fast swap of a component. Expect a tech to evaluate gas stress, clock the meter if needed, gauge burning or component present, validate draft, and examine for indications of wetness. Realistic Expense Varies and What Drives Them

Costs differ by access, brand name, warranty, and code needs. A straightforward fixing like a thermocouple or igniter on a gas storage tank might land in a small variety, while a control valve or electric aspect can be greater. Full hot water heater installation in Chicago for a standard atmospheric gas container generally includes the device, brand-new flex ports, drip leg, TPR piping to code, license, and haul-away of the old storage tank. Add prices for a brand-new chimney lining if needed, or for a power-vent version with long air vent runs and condensate drainpipe configuration.

Tankless setups have a bigger spread. If the gas line have to be upsized and the air vent route drilled through masonry with a future, the labor increases. Descaling shutoffs and isolation packages include cost upfront but save operating expense later on. Crossbreed heat pumps set you back more than standard electric tanks, and you may need a condensate pump, vibration seclusion pads, and perhaps a little duct kit to maximize airflow.

Ask for made a list of quotes so you can see where the money goes. Low bids that leave out authorization charges, venting upgrades, or development tanks commonly balloon later on or lead to a system that works poorly.

Practical Actions Property owners Can Take Today

A short, targeted checklist keeps you ahead of issues without diving right into professional territory.

  • Locate and label the cold-water shutoff and the gas shutoff or breaker for your heater. Technique transforming them off.
  • Check the TPR valve discharge pipeline. It must terminate within a few inches of a drain or frying pan, not covered. If you see active dripping, timetable service.
  • Note your heating system's age from the identification number. If it mores than 8 years for gas or ten for electrical, prepare for replacement, not simply repairs.
  • Test warm water healing. Time the length of time it requires to recuperate after a shower. A sudden modification commonly signals sediment or control issues.
  • Clear a two-foot span around the system. Keep combustibles away and guarantee airflow.

What I 'd Recommend in Common Chicago Scenarios

In an older brick bungalow with a sound smokeshaft and a family members of 4, a 50-gallon climatic gas storage tank remains a dependable, economical selection, offered the smokeshaft is lined and the cellar isn't starved for air. Include an appropriately sized development tank and schedule annual flushes.

In a garden system with limited access and only one bath, a small tankless can free space and take care of 2 fixtures at once if sized correctly for wintertime inlet water. Strategy a descaling regimen and install seclusion shutoffs from day one.

In an apartment with no gas, an 80-gallon electric container supplies comfortable recuperation if the panel can support it. If the wardrobe is tight and you desire performance, a crossbreed heatpump works if you approve a cooler closet and configure condensate properly. I've seen locals appreciate the dehumidification result in summer.

For two-flat proprietors that provide warm water to lessees, redundancy issues. 2 medium tankless devices in parallel with a controller give flexibility. If one fails, the other maintains standard solution while you await components. This arrangement likewise regulates far better at reduced need than a single extra-large unit.

Seasonal Tips That Pay Off

Before the first hard freeze, walk the outside. If your heater vents via a sidewall, check the discontinuation for insect nests or particles. Validate the discontinuation is high sufficient over grade to prevent snow obstruction. Inside, validate that the condensate lines on power-vent or condensing systems are sloped and that catches include water to prevent exhaust recirculation.

During long cold wave, pay attention for new rattles or modifications in heater noise. Abrupt boosts in burner sound or extended shooting cycles usually line up with flue limitations or hefty sediment activity. On exceptionally gusty days, sidewall-vented systems can short-cycle from pressure disruptions near the vent. Proper vent termination positioning decreases this; including a wind-resistant cap can help.

In spring, moisture climbs up and cellar moisture rises. Look for rust on copper-to-steel changes and at the nipple areas on top of the storage tank. I usually see very early corrosion at these joints from minor sweating, not from leaks. A basic wipe-down and examination routine once a month informs you a lot.

What Makes an Excellent Installment, Not Simply a Brand-new Heater

A neat install is more than clean piping. It means right burning air calculations, vent pitch, gas sizing, dielectric Bradford White water heater Chicago isolation between different metals, and a drip leg on the gas line. It indicates the TPR discharge does not run uphill and that the frying pan under the heating unit, if made use of, has a drainpipe to someplace that can deal with water. It also means realistic discussion about water top quality. In some homes, a point-of-entry conditioner can add years to the system. In others, a straightforward range prevention cartridge upstream of a tankless system is enough.

Documentation issues. Maintain your authorization, model numbers, guarantee info, and a basic service log. When you ask for water heater repair work in Chicago years later, handing a tech those notes saves analysis time and lowers billable hours.

What are the 4 types of water heaters?

The four main types of water heaters are tank (storage) heaters, tankless (on-demand) heaters, heat pump water heaters, and solar water heaters. Tank heaters store heated water, while tankless units heat water on demand. Heat pumps and solar models use energy-efficient methods for heating water.

How many years will a water heater last?

The lifespan of a water heater depends on its type and maintenance. Tank water heaters typically last 8 to 12 years, while tankless models can last 15 to 20 years. Regular maintenance can extend the life of any water heater.
